What is Schmoochle in My Singing Monsters?
Schmoochle is a two-headed monster that is quite the catch! This elusive monster only shows up during the Season of Love and Season Shanty, and can be found on Gold, Air, Colossingum, and Season Islands. If you’re lucky enough to come across Schmoochle during the Season Shanty, you’re in luck! You’ll be able to breed it anytime while it’s available. But, keep in mind that Schmoochle is a rare and time-limited monster, so grab it while you can!

More Information
Schmoochle is a holiday Monster that is available during the Season of Love, found on Air Island. It was first introduced to the game on February 5th, 2013 with Version 1.1.1. As a seasonal Monster, it’s only available at certain times of the year. The best way to get a Schmoochle is by breeding Riff and Tweedle, with a breeding time of 1 day, 7 hours, 6 minutes, and 30 seconds. Sadly, Schmoochle is not a great coin producer.
Once Schmoochle is fed to level 15, it can be teleported to Seasonal Shanty. However, even on Seasonal Shanty, Schmoochle still has a low coin production compared to other Monsters on the island.
